Output abdcfd995b8b180f2d8a7f0dd32c56f32c35b5fa88b7c79dd24e0e898ca73d4a:0

value
2644921
script pubkey
OP_0 OP_PUSHBYTES_20 89ec36b23c3bf334d563fec2848d9b0aebee10d7
address
bc1q38krdv3u80enf4trlmpgfrvmpt47uyxhe0w4d0
transaction
abdcfd995b8b180f2d8a7f0dd32c56f32c35b5fa88b7c79dd24e0e898ca73d4a
confirmations
101
spent
true